EXCLUSIVE: MGM+ has given a sequence order to The Institute, a thriller primarily based on the 2019 Stephen King novel. Ben Barnes (Shadow and Bone) and Mary-Louise Parker (Weeds) are set to guide the drama from director/government producer Jack Bender (Misplaced, Mr. Mercedes), author/government producer Benjamin Cavell (Justified, The Stand) and MGM+ Studios. Manufacturing is slated to start in Nova Scotia later this yr.

Within the eight-episode The Institute, When 12-year-old genius Luke Ellis is kidnapped, he awakens at The Institute, a facility full of youngsters who all acquired there the identical approach he did, and who’re all possessed of surprising talents. In a close-by city, haunted former police officer Tim Jamieson (Barnes) has come trying to begin a brand new life, however the peace and quiet received’t final, as his story and Luke’s are destined to collide.

Barnes’ Tim Jamieson is a disillusioned ex-cop who takes a job because the night time knocker in a small city, withdrawing from the world till Luke’s plight reignites him and provides him one thing to consider in.

Parker, who I hear has a one-year deal, will play Ms. Sigsby, the charming however iron-willed director of the Institute and a real believer in its terrible mission. She’s sure historical past will come to see her as a hero.

“I’m delighted and excited on the prospect of The Institute, with its high-intensity suspense, being filmed as a sequence,” King stated. “The mix of Jack Bender and Ben Cavell ensures that the outcomes shall be terrific.”

The Institute follows one other sequence by MGM+ primarily based on King’s literary work, Chapelwaite.

Bender has in depth expertise in King sequence variations, having government produced CBS’ Underneath The Dome; Viewers’s Mr. Mercedes, whose Season 1 forged included Parker; and HBO’s The Outsider. At MGM+, he’s additionally director/government producer on hit horror sequence From, which counts King amongst its followers.

When The Institute was revealed in 2019, it was originally acquired by Spyglass for the Mr. Mercedes group of author/EP David E. Kelley and EP Bender. It is a new incarnation of the venture with a brand new author and studio.

“I’m thrilled that Stephen King has entrusted me with one other of his good novels and persevering with the extraordinary inventive relationship with Michael Wright and MGM+,” Bender stated. “Working alongside Ben Cavell and a group of outstanding writers, to inform the story of those uniquely gifted youngsters, will guarantee a suspenseful and engrossing sequence.”

Cavell is coming off adapting King’s novel The Stand into the 2020 Paramount+ miniseries of the identical identify.
